Matt Maglodi Racing launches a hybrid sponsorship model linking grassroots motorsports with digital marketing services for small businesses

Executive summary: Matt Maglodi Racing unveiled a new small business motorsports sponsorship program on August 10, 2026, that pairs grassroots racing exposure with digital marketing services including content creation and online advertising. The program addresses two key pain points: small businesses’ need for affordable, measurable marketing and amateur racers’ struggle to fund participation costs, creating a value-exchange model in an underfunded segment of motorsports.

Who is involved: Matt Maglodi Racing (organizer), small business sponsors (target audience), and amateur drivers in the grassroots racing circuit (beneficiaries).

Likely next: The program will begin enrolling small businesses in Q4 2026, with pilot events scheduled at regional tracks in the Southeast U.S., followed by performance reporting on sponsor ROI and driver participation rates.

Matt Maglodi Racing announced a new sponsorship program on August 10, 2026, designed to help small businesses gain affordable digital marketing exposure while supporting amateur racers in offsetting competition costs. The initiative combines grassroots racing visibility with content creation and online marketing services, targeting local enterprises seeking cost-effective brand outreach. By integrating motorsports sponsorship with measurable digital deliverables, the program aims to create a mutually beneficial ecosystem for sponsors and drivers in the amateur racing circuit. The announcement reflects a growing trend of niche sports entities leveraging digital marketing partnerships to expand revenue streams beyond traditional sponsorship models.
